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,034 in Medellin versus $843 in George Town.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,577 in Medellin versus $1,306 in George Town.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,120 in Medellin versus $1,769 in George Town.

Living in Medellin is roughly 23% more expensive than George Town,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both cities sit below the global median: Medellin 23% lower, George Town 37% lower.
